Alright, now how about that boxwood sideboard this post is named after? I found this little piece at the thrift shop last week. I wasn't feeling it. I walked by. I went back and opened the drawer. I hemmed. I hawed. I walked away. I walked back over and repeated the cycle. It still wasn't speaking to me, but the price was too good to pass up, and it was a Sellers brand cabinet, so good quality, so I bought it. Here is the uninspiring piece in its before....
You see? It's just so plan, and I am not a fan of the rounded edges, the finish was uneven and it's ugly oak, not my favorite, and let's not even talk about the ugly knobs, ok? Uninspiring. But the sweet deal convinced me I could do something with it. I knew it needed a fun color since there was nothing else to make it stand out. I had ordered Miss Mustard Seed's Boxwood Milk Paint from the lovely ladies over at Vintage Shabby Chicks and was wanting to try it so this was the perfect chance!
Because the finish on this was uneven, I gave it a quick light allover sanding, and of course removed those knobs! :) I mixed up my paint and gave it two coats. I distressed it by hand and then I finished it by waxing it with a clear wax. I still was not really in love, so I gave it some funky colorful flowered knobs from Hobby Lobby. Here is the final product! I have to admit it's still not one of my favorites, but it's an improvement!
